Asymmetric diffusion of magnetic skyrmions in a structured chamber
2+ week, 5+ day ago (77+ words) (IMAGE) EurekAlert! Magnetic skyrmions diffuse more easily from the left chamber to the right chamber owing to their nontrivial random-walk dynamics and topology-dependent interactions with the off-center asymmetric gate. This mechanism offers a promising route toward unconventional artificial intelligence hardware....
